Ultimate Guide to Cleaning Supplies
Cleaning supplies are essential for keeping your home sparkling and hygienic. But with so many different types of cleaners available, it can be tough to know which ones to choose. This guide will walk you through the most popular cleaning supplies and help you choose the right ones for your needs.
First, let's talk about all-purpose cleaners. These are great for removing general messes on hard surfaces more info like countertops, sinks, and floors. Popular brands include Mr. Clean. For tougher stains and grime, you might need a more powerful cleaner. Consider heavy-duty cleaners that contain bleach or other ingredients to dissolve stubborn dirt.
Another essential cleaning supply is a good disinfectant. Disinfectants destroy germs and bacteria, making them important for keeping your home sanitary. Look for disinfectants that are EPA-registered and effective against the bacteria that are most common in your area.
Don't forget about specialized cleaners! {For example|Including glass cleaners, bathroom cleaners, and floor cleaners are designed to efficiently clean specific surfaces without damaging them.
Finally, always remember to review the label instructions before using any cleaning product. This will help you use it safely and properly.

Tackling Tough Stains with Powerful Cleaners
Confronting those pesky tough stains can feel like an uphill battle. But fear not! A arsenal of effective cleaners is at your disposal to tackle even the worst messes. From organic solutions to industrial-strength formulas, there's a perfect choice for every type of stain. Before you reach to harsh chemicals, consider mild methods like baking soda or vinegar, which can often work wonders on everyday marks. For deeper stains, however, a targeted stain remover is your best bet. Always follow the guidelines carefully and test the cleaner in an inconspicuous area first to avoid any unintended damage.
